Madison Pointe Care Center in New Port Richey, FL is a premier assisted living community that provides exceptional care and a comfortable living environment for seniors. With a range of amenities and care services, residents can enjoy a fulfilling and worry-free lifestyle.
The community offers numerous amenities to enhance the residents' quality of life. There is a beauty salon on-site for convenient grooming services, as well as cable or satellite TV in each room for entertainment. Community-operated transportation is available for outings and appointments, ensuring residents have easy access to the surrounding area. A computer center allows residents to stay connected with loved ones and engage in online activities. The dining room offers restaurant-style dining with delicious meals prepared by skilled chefs, catering to special dietary restrictions. A fitness room is provided for maintaining physical health, and there are fully furnished private rooms with their own bathrooms.
In addition to these amenities, Madison Pointe Care Center offers various care services to meet the individual needs of residents. There is 24-hour call system and supervision to ensure the safety and well-being of all residents. Trained staff provide assistance with daily activities such as bathing, dressing, and transfers. Medication management is also available to ensure proper administration of prescribed medications. Special dietary restrictions like diabetes diets are taken into consideration during meal preparation.
Residents at Madison Pointe Care Center can enjoy an active lifestyle through a variety of activities offered by the community. Fitness programs help residents maintain their physical health while planned day trips provide opportunities for exploration and socialization outside the community. Resident-run activities allow individuals to engage with their peers while scheduled daily activities provide entertainment and engagement within the community.
The surrounding area offers additional conveniences for residents with several cafes, parks, pharmacies, physicians' offices, restaurants, places of worship, transportation options nearby. These amenities enhance the accessibility and convenience of daily life.
